Weblogic配置Oracle数据源时,如何确保高效稳定连接?

在WebLogic Server中配置Oracle数据源是确保应用程序能够成功连接到Oracle数据库的关键步骤,以下是如何在WebLogic中配置Oracle数据源的详细指南。

Weblogic配置Oracle数据源时,如何确保高效稳定连接?

准备工作

在开始配置之前,请确保以下准备工作已经完成:

  • Oracle数据库已安装并运行。
  • 已创建用于WebLogic数据源的用户。
  • WebLogic Server已经启动。

创建Oracle连接池

连接池是WebLogic中用于管理数据库连接的组件,以下是创建Oracle连接池的步骤:

1 登录WebLogic管理控制台

  1. 打开浏览器,输入WebLogic管理控制台的URL(通常是http://localhost:7001/console)。
  2. 输入管理员凭据登录。

2 创建数据源

  1. 在控制台中,导航到“Domain Structure”下的“Resources”。
  2. 点击“New”按钮,选择“JDBC Data Source”。

3 配置数据源

  1. 在“Create JDBC Data Source”页面,输入以下信息:

    • Name: OracleDS
    • JDBC Driver Module: 选择Oracle JDBC驱动,通常位于Oracle Home/jdbc/lib
    • JNDI Name: jdbc/OracleDS
    • Connection Pool: 选择“Create a new connection pool”。
  2. 点击“Next”。

    Weblogic配置Oracle数据源时,如何确保高效稳定连接?

4 配置连接池

  1. 在“Connection Pool”页面,输入以下信息:

    • Name: OraclePool
    • Type: 选择“Basic”。
  2. 点击“Next”。

5 配置数据库连接

  1. 在“Database Connection”页面,输入以下信息:

    • Database Driver Class: oracle.jdbc.OracleDriver
    • URL: Oracle数据库的连接URL,例如jdbc:oracle:thin:@localhost:1521:xe
    • Username: 用于连接数据库的用户名。
    • Password: 用于连接数据库的密码。
  2. 点击“Next”。

    Weblogic配置Oracle数据源时,如何确保高效稳定连接?

6 配置连接验证

  1. 在“Connection Validation”页面,选择“Always validate connection”。
  2. 点击“Next”。

7 配置连接属性

  1. 在“Connection Attributes”页面,可以根据需要添加或修改连接属性。
  2. 点击“Next”。

8 完成创建

  1. 在“Summary”页面,检查所有配置信息。
  2. 点击“Finish”完成创建。

测试数据源

创建数据源后,需要测试以确保其正常工作。

  1. 在“JDBC Data Source”列表中,找到刚刚创建的数据源。
  2. 点击“Test Connection”按钮。
  3. 如果测试成功,将显示一条消息“Connection test succeeded”。

FAQs

Q1: 为什么我的应用程序无法连接到Oracle数据库?

A1: 请检查以下可能的原因:

  • 数据源配置不正确,例如URL、用户名或密码错误。
  • 数据库服务器未启动或不可达。
  • 数据库用户权限不足。

Q2: 如何查看数据源的性能指标?

A2: 在WebLogic管理控制台中,导航到“Performance”标签,然后选择“JDBC Data Sources”和您要查看的数据源,您可以查看连接池的性能指标,如连接数、活跃连接数和等待连接数。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/154336.html

(0)
上一篇 2025年12月12日 12:33
下一篇 2025年12月12日 12:38

相关推荐

  • 联想b470e笔记本配置如何,现在还值得购买使用吗?

    联想B470e作为当年面向中小企业及个人用户推出的一款高性价比商用笔记本,以其稳定的性能、扎实的做工和亲民的价格,在市场上赢得了不错的口碑,尽管以今天的标准来看,它已是一款“古董级”的产品,但其配置设计理念与硬件组合,依然代表了那个时代的主流水平,深入剖析其配置,不仅能让我们了解一款经典产品的设计思路,也能为仍……

    2025年10月17日
    0900
  • 华为s5700交换机dhcp如何配置才能自动分配ip?

    在现代化的企业网络环境中,动态主机配置协议(DHCP)是不可或缺的核心服务之一,它能够自动为网络中的客户端设备分配IP地址、子网掩码、网关地址以及DNS服务器等关键网络参数,极大地减轻了网络管理员的工作负担,提升了网络部署和管理的效率,华为S5700系列交换机作为一款广泛应用的接入层交换机,不仅具备强大的二层和……

    2025年10月16日
    02110
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 安全知识,如何避免日常生活中的安全隐患?

    安全知识日常生活中的安全防护在快节奏的现代生活中,安全知识是每个人必备的“生存技能”,无论是居家、出行还是工作,掌握基本的安全常识能有效降低风险,保护自己与他人的生命财产安全,居家安全:细节决定安危居家环境看似安全,却潜藏多种隐患,用电安全是首要关注点:避免电器线路超负荷运行,老旧插座及时更换;使用电暖器等设备……

    2025年10月28日
    0510
  • 安全用电云平台如何实现电气火灾隐患实时预警?

    安全用电云平台的概述随着电力需求的持续增长和用电安全问题的日益凸显,传统用电管理模式逐渐显露出局限性:人工巡检效率低、数据采集滞后、隐患响应不及时等,在此背景下,安全用电云平台应运而生,它融合物联网、大数据、云计算及人工智能技术,构建了一套“感知-分析-预警-处置”的智能化用电安全管理体系,该平台通过实时监测电……

    2025年11月2日
    0560

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注